Bugzy Malone Announces Upcoming Album ‘The Resurrection’

Bugzy Malone has announced his upcoming album, The Resurrection.

News of the LP was released in a press release this morning (November 20), as well as by Bugzy himself who changed his Twitter header to a poster for the record.

Due for release on January 22nd 2021, The Resurrection will serve as the Manchester artist’s fifth, full-length project, following on from his 2018 tape B. Inspired.

The forthcoming album from Bugzy will include his singles “M.E.N III”, “Doe’d Up” and his brand-new single “Don’t Cry” – which he uses to detail his near-fatal accident in March.

Since making waves in the scene in 2015, Bugzy Malone has gone onto become one of the biggest names in the UK with his raw and honest material and if his past releases are anything to go by, The Resurrection will be yet another well-formed body of work from the artist.
